The Deputy Program Manager (DPM) directs daily operations, including Visitor Processing, Badge Room/HSPD-12, Mail Screening, and Currency Destruction. The DPM ensures compliance with Key Performance Indicators (KPIs), staff scheduling, and occupational safety standards (OSHA 1910.95). This role also serves as a floater, providing coverage and leadership support for critical posts as needed.

Duties & Responsibilities:



  • Deputy Program Manager will supervise daily operations for Visitor Processing, Badge Room, Mail Screening, and Currency Destruction activities.
  • Manage Homeland Security Presidential Directive-12 (HSPD-12) workflows, ensuring badge issuance, accountability, and compliance.
  • Deputy Program Manager will enforce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) and OSHA safety standards, schedule reliefs for physically demanding tasks.
  • Prepare and maintain weekly and monthly operational reports; implement the Quality Control Plan (QCP) and corrective actions as required.
  • Deputy Program Manager will serve as a floater to backfill critical posts and manage overtime in coordination with the Contracting Officer's Representative (COR).
  • Other duties as assigned.
